From Paris to Jeddah: Lola’s New Menu Celebrates French-Mediterranean Flair 

Jeddah, Saudi Arabia – Lola Brasserie, Jeddah’s celebrated destination where French elegance meets Mediterranean ease, unveils a new chapter in its culinary journey with the introduction of seasonal creations. Rooted in Lola’s philosophy of refined simplicity and inspired by the sun-soaked coasts of Southern France, the refreshed menu continues to honour the art of living well, where gastronomy, style, and storytelling come together in perfect harmony.
The new dishes reflect Lola’s distinctive balance between comfort and sophistication, offering approachable yet elevated flavours, familiar yet intriguing combinations, and presentations that are both graceful and inviting. Highlights include Classic French Onion Soup a rich classic crowned with a creamy, golden gratin, Tarte a la Tomate with Burrata a flaky, buttery tart layered with sweet roasted tomatoes and finished with silky, creamy burrata, the Lola Pasta – a comforting, signature house recipe showcasing elegant simplicity. Guests are also invited to savour the all-new Lobster Pasta, Veal Tenderloin Milanese and much-loved Steak Aux Poivres, with green peppercorn sauce and watercress.
